Does JetBlue offer direct flights to Las Vegas?
Yes, JetBlue offers direct flights to Las Vegas from several major cities.
What are the popular routes JetBlue flies to Las Vegas?
Popular routes include flights from New York, Boston, and Fort Lauderdale to Las Vegas.
